Ranking of Georgia Cities and Places By Population with Zimbabwean Ancestry in 2021
Updated on April 16, 2025.
Based on the US Census ACS-5Yrs estimates, in 2021, there were 1.15K people in Georgia with Zimbabwean ancestry. Among all Georgia cities and places, Clarkston city had the highest population with Zimbabwean ancestry (292), followed by Johns Creek city (200), and Kennesaw city (123).

| Rank | City or Place | Population |
|---|---|---|
| 1 | Clarkston city | 292 |
| 2 | Johns Creek city | 200 |
| 3 | Kennesaw city | 123 |
| 4 | Fairburn city | 61 |
| 5 | Peachtree City city | 43 |
| 6 | Pooler city | 32 |
| 7 | Redan CDP | 19 |
| 8 | Lawrenceville city | 13 |
